Abstract
By integrating distributed storage with visualization technologies, cloud storage provides an effective solution to huge network data storage. By integrating P2P techniques into pure cloud, a reliable cloud storage P2Pcloud is proposed. In P2Pcloud, an extendable cloud built on unstructured P2P topology can share heavy load of storage cloud so that a core cloud based on a chord ring can focus on backup of metadata. Thus, it can guarantee good QoS for immensely multiuser and high scalability of the whole system.
